Brush mulching, also known as brush cutting or forestry mulching, offers a multitude of benefits for landowners and property managers. This eco-friendly land clearing method involves using specialized machinery to grind trees, shrubs, and vegetation into mulch, leaving the ground undisturbed. One of the key advantages of brush mulching is its ability to quickly and efficiently clear large areas of overgrown land, reducing the need for manual labor and heavy machinery. This process also helps to control and prevent the spread of invasive species, as the mulch acts as a natural barrier against regrowth. Additionally, brush mulching promotes soil health by returning organic matter back into the ground, which enhances nutrient content and moisture retention. By minimizing soil erosion and improving overall land aesthetics, brush mulching proves to be a cost-effective and sustainable solution for land management.


Brush mulching is a highly effective land clearing technique that involves using specialized machinery to grind and shred vegetation, such as trees, shrubs, and brush, into small wood chips. This process not only helps to clear the land efficiently but also aids in promoting healthy soil and preventing erosion. Brush mulching is an eco-friendly alternative to traditional methods as it eliminates the need for burning or hauling away debris. By utilizing this method, landowners can restore overgrown areas, create firebreaks, establish trails, and enhance the overall aesthetics of their property.

Q: What Is The Process Of Brush Mulching And How Does It Work?

Answer: Brush mulching is a land clearing process that involves using specialized equipment to grind vegetation, such as small trees, shrubs, and brush, into mulch. This is achieved by a machine with a rotary drum that has sharp teeth, which quickly and efficiently cuts and shreds the vegetation. The mulch is then spread across the cleared area, providing a natural ground cover that helps control erosion, retain moisture, and promote healthy soil.

Q: What Are The Benefits Of Brush Mulching For Landowners Or Property Managers?

Answer: The benefits of brush mulching for landowners or property managers include improved land aesthetics, reduced fire hazards, enhanced wildlife habitat, increased soil health and moisture retention, and cost-effective vegetation management.
